Home
/
Beginner guides
/
Binary options explained
/

Understanding binary representation of numbers

Understanding Binary Representation of Numbers

By

Emily Turner

9 Apr 2026, 12:00 am

Edited By

Emily Turner

11 minutes of reading

Foreword

Understanding how numbers are represented in binary is central for anyone involved in computing or digital technologies. Unlike the decimal system, which uses ten digits (0 to 9), the binary system works with just two: 0 and 1. This simplicity aligns perfectly with how digital circuits operate, making binary the backbone of all computing devices.

For traders, investors, financial analysts, and cryptocurrency enthusiasts, grasping binary representation helps demystify the technology behind algorithms, encryption methods, and computer processing systems that influence market data analysis and transaction security.

Diagram showing binary digits representing different powers of two
top

The binary system is a base-2 numeral system. Each binary digit, or bit, holds a place value that's a power of two, moving from right to left. For example, the binary number 1011 represents:

  • 1 × 2³ (8)

  • 0 × 2² (0)

  • 1 × 2¹ (2)

  • 1 × 2⁰ (1)

Adding these up gives 8 + 0 + 2 + 1 = 11 in decimal.

Here’s why binary is preferred in technology:

  • Simplicity in hardware: Digital circuits interpret two voltage levels (high/low) as binary states 1/0.

  • Reliability: Less prone to errors compared to multi-level systems.

  • Efficient processing: Bit-level operations speed up computations essential for real-time trading platforms and blockchain validation.

In this article, you'll find clear methods to convert decimal numbers to binary and vice versa. We will also explore how negative numbers use specific binary formats like two’s complement to avoid confusion during calculations.

Understanding these concepts empowers you to better appreciate the functioning of digital ledgers, algorithmic trading tools, and cryptocurrency wallets. You'll see how binary representation underpins the technology shaping modern financial markets.

This foundational knowledge is not just academic; it can deepen your insight into the mechanics of the digital economy and enhance your engagement with technology-driven financial instruments.

Basics of Number Systems

Understanding the basics of number systems is fundamental when dealing with digital computing and electronics. For traders, investors, and financial analysts, such knowledge helps in grasping how data is stored, processed, and conveyed in computers and devices they use daily. The binary number system forms the backbone of all digital operations, making its basic concepts essential for anyone venturing deeper into computer science or fintech.

Foreword to Decimal and Binary Systems

Differences Between Decimal and Binary

The decimal system is the number system most of us use daily. It has ten digits, from 0 to 9, and each place represents a power of ten. For example, the number 345 means 3 × 100 + 4 × 10 + 5 × 1. Binary, on the other hand, uses only two digits: 0 and 1. Each position in a binary number represents a power of two. For instance, the binary number 1011 equals 1 × 8 + 0 × 4 + 1 × 2 + 1 × 1, which is 11 in decimal.

This fundamental difference means binary is more suited for digital circuits, where on/off states correspond naturally to 1s and 0s. While decimal aligns with human counting habits, binary aligns better with electronic hardware, which simplifies design, reliability, and speed.

Place Value Concept in Binary

Just like in decimal, the place value of digits in binary determines the number's total value. Each bit (binary digit) has a weight that doubles moving left, starting from 2⁰ = 1 on the rightmost bit. For example, in 1101, the place values from right to left are 1, 2, 4, and 8. Summing bits multiplied by their place values gives the decimal equivalent; thus, 1101 is 8 + 4 + 0 + 1 = 13.

For practical use in finance technology, understanding place value matters when interpreting binary-coded data, such as financial transactions or encrypted messages. It ensures clarity when converting or decoding binary information.

Importance of Binary in Computing

Binary's dominance in computing stems from its simplicity and reliability. Electronic devices such as processors and memory chips use two voltage levels—high and low—to represent 1s and 0s. This makes error detection easier and hardware cheaper.

In trading platforms or cryptocurrency networks, large amounts of data are processed at lightning speed using binary arithmetic. Understanding binary concepts helps traders and investors appreciate how complex computations and encryptions happen behind the scenes to secure transactions and analyse market trends.

Grasping the basics of decimal and binary systems paves the way for better insight into how modern technology manages and interprets numerical data, which is crucial in today's data-driven financial world.

Key takeaways:

  • Decimal system uses ten digits with place values as powers of ten.

  • Binary system uses two digits with place values as powers of two.

  • Binary aligns naturally with electronic hardware, making computing efficient.

This section builds the foundation for converting numbers between these systems and understanding their usage in digital electronics and programming.

How Binary Numbers Are Formed

Binary numbers form the backbone of all digital systems, including the computers and stock trading platforms familiar to investors and analysts. Knowing how these numbers are constructed helps you understand how data—be it stock prices, transaction volumes, or charts—is stored and processed behind the scenes.

Binary Digits and Their Values

Understanding Bits

Comparison chart illustrating decimal numbers converted to binary equivalents
top

A bit is the smallest unit of data in computing, representing a simple choice between two states: 0 or 1. Think of it like a tiny switch that can be off (0) or on (1). These bits combine to represent any number or piece of data. For example, the number 5 in decimal can be expressed using bits in binary as 101. Traders should recognise that each bit's position affects its value, just as digits in decimal numbers do.

Understanding bits is critical because all complex data and commands in trading software break down into these fundamental pieces. Without grasping bits, it’s hard to appreciate how numbers like share prices get encoded reliably and efficiently.

Significance of and

The use of only two symbols, 0 and 1, in binary might seem limiting, but it simplifies electronic circuit design. A 0 represents the absence of current or a low voltage, while 1 indicates the presence or high voltage. This simplicity makes computers more stable and less prone to errors—a reason why binary dominates computing.

In trading tools, this means data transfer and storage are highly efficient and less vulnerable to noise or signal degradation. Every price update or trade confirmation you see involves billions of these 0s and 1s moving through circuits and networks.

Converting Decimal Numbers to Binary

Division-by-2

To convert decimal numbers into binary, the division-by-2 method is straightforward and practical. You divide the decimal number by 2 repeatedly, recording the remainder each time — which will be either 0 or 1. Once the division reaches zero, you collect the remainders in reverse order to form the binary equivalent.

This method is handy when you want to understand how decimal figures used in finance translate into their underlying binary form. For example, converting a rupee value or a stock quantity to binary can be done manually using this approach.

Examples of Conversion

Let’s say you want to convert the decimal number 13 into binary:

  1. Divide 13 by 2; quotient = 6, remainder = 1

  2. Divide 6 by 2; quotient = 3, remainder = 0

  3. Divide 3 by 2; quotient = 1, remainder = 1

  4. Divide 1 by 2; quotient = 0, remainder = 1

Reading remainders from bottom to top gives 1101 — the binary form of 13.

This simple example illustrates how seemingly complex numbers break down into binary digits, which then power the electronics processing your market data.

Binary formation is not just a technicality but a framework enabling the accuracy and speed of modern financial systems.

Understanding binary numbers and their formation helps illuminate how data moves invisibly yet instantaneously in your trading apps and in the exchanges themselves.

Converting Binary Back to Decimal

Converting binary numbers back to decimal is essential for understanding how computers interpret and use data. Since human beings familiarise with decimal (base-10) numbers in daily life, decoding binary (base-2) into decimal helps bridge the gap between machine language and human comprehension. For traders, investors, or anyone analysing data that flows through digital systems, grasping this concept makes it easier to interpret raw computational outputs or understand underlying processes.

Method to Calculate Decimal Value from Binary

Weighted Sum of Bits

The most straightforward way to convert a binary number to decimal exploits the 'weighted sum of bits' method. Each bit in a binary number holds a positional value, which is a power of two, starting with 2⁰ for the rightmost bit and increasing by a power of 2 with each step to the left. To calculate the decimal equivalent, you multiply each bit by its positional value and add these results together.

For instance, in the binary number 1011, the rightmost '1' represents 2⁰ (which is 1), the next bit '1' represents 2¹ (2), then '0' for 2² (0), and the leftmost '1' stands for 2³ (8). Adding these up: 8 + 0 + 2 + 1 gives the decimal number 11. This method is practical because it directly maps the binary structure into decimal without complex rules, useful in financial computing where accurate number representation is key.

Worked Examples

Let's look at a more concrete example. Take the binary number 11010. To convert it:

  • 1 × 2⁴ = 16

  • 1 × 2³ = 8

  • 0 × 2² = 0

  • 1 × 2¹ = 2

  • 0 × 2⁰ = 0

Adding these gives 16 + 8 + 0 + 2 + 0 = 26 in decimal. This example highlights how even seemingly complex binary strings break down neatly into sums of powers of two.

Another example is 100101, often seen in digital protocols. Breaking it down:

  • 1 × 2⁵ = 32

  • 0 × 2⁴ = 0

  • 0 × 2³ = 0

  • 1 × 2² = 4

  • 0 × 2¹ = 0

  • 1 × 2⁰ = 1

Summing these values yields 32 + 0 + 0 + 4 + 0 + 1 = 37 decimal.

Understanding these conversions allows you to interpret binary-coded data from financial software or blockchain transactions effectively, ensuring you see the real numeric values behind the code.

By mastering this method, you can confidently work with binary data generated from market analysis tools or cryptocurrency ledgers, helping you avoid misinterpretation and supporting better decision-making.

Representing Negative Numbers in Binary

Negative numbers are essential in computing, especially for financial calculations, stock analysis, and algorithmic trading. Without representing negatives effectively, computers would struggle with losses, debts, or any transaction involving below-zero values. Binary, by default, handles only positive numbers, so computer systems use special methods to encode negatives reliably.

Sign-Magnitude Representation

How Sign Bit Works
Sign-magnitude representation is straightforward—it dedicates the leftmost bit (most significant bit) as the sign bit. If this bit is 0, the number is positive; if 1, negative. The remaining bits represent the magnitude (absolute value). For example, in an 8-bit system, 00001010 means +10, while 10001010 means -10.

This method mirrors the decimal approach with signs but in binary. It’s simple to understand and useful when quick sign detection matters, like checking whether a stock price change is gain or loss.

Limitations and Usage
Despite its simplicity, sign-magnitude has drawbacks. Arithmetic operations like addition and subtraction get complicated because sign bits need separate handling. For instance, adding -5 and +7 requires extra logic to compare magnitudes and manage signs.

Consequently, most modern processors avoid using sign-magnitude for calculations. It finds limited use in scenarios where representing sign explicitly suffices, but precise arithmetic isn’t needed. For traders or analysts dealing with computational models, its inefficiency makes it less practical.

Two's Complement System

Conversion Process
Two's complement is the preferred way to represent negatives in binary arithmetic. To find the two's complement of a number, invert all bits and add one. For example, take 00000101 (5 in binary). Inverting all bits gives 11111010. Adding one results in 11111011, which represents -5.

This system simplifies calculations because addition and subtraction of signed numbers use the same hardware logic, without separate sign handling. For example, calculating profit and loss in trading software becomes seamless.

Advantages Over Sign-Magnitude
Two's complement offers several benefits:

  • It eliminates the complexity of managing sign bits separately in arithmetic.

  • It provides a unique zero representation, unlike sign-magnitude, which has both positive and negative zero.

  • Operations like subtraction can be done using addition of two's complement, streamlining computer algorithms.

This efficiency is why two’s complement forms the backbone of signed number representation in most processors and programming languages used in trading tools and financial modelling.

For anyone working with financial data or algorithmic trading, understanding two's complement helps in appreciating how computers handle negative values without error, ensuring reliable computation and analysis.

Applications of Binary Representation

Binary numbers form the backbone of modern digital technology, influencing how electronic devices operate and communicate. By representing information in just two states—0 and 1—binary simplifies complex processes and enhances reliability in systems ranging from small gadgets to large data centres.

Role in Digital Electronics and Computing

Binary in Logic Circuits

At the heart of digital electronics lie logic circuits, which use binary signals to perform decisions and control tasks. Each logic gate—AND, OR, NOT, among others—processes input signals represented by 0s and 1s to produce an output. For example, a simple AND gate will output 1 only if all its inputs are 1. This binary logic enables devices like smartphones, computers, and television sets to process instructions and manage tasks effectively.

These circuits rely on binary’s clarity for fault tolerance and ease of manufacturing. Even when the input signals vary slightly due to noise, the system can still identify them as either high (1) or low (0). Industries depend on this binary foundation to build microprocessors, sensors, and memory units that form the computing landscape.

Data Storage and Processing

Binary representation is essential for storing vast amounts of data in electronic form. Hard drives, solid-state drives, and memory chips organise information as sequences of 0s and 1s. For instance, a single character like ‘A’ in a text document is stored using its binary ASCII code (01000001). This uniform approach allows computers to manage text, images, and videos consistently.

When processing data, computers perform millions of binary operations every second to execute programmes. Arithmetic and logical operations depend on binary calculations within the central processing unit (CPU). This uniformity makes scaling hardware simpler: more bits mean more precision and capacity, which directly benefits speed and accuracy.

Binary in Programming and Data Transmission

Use in Machine Language

At the lowest level, all computer instructions are expressed in machine language—a string of binary codes that the processor reads directly. Each command, whether it’s adding numbers or jumping to a different program part, converts into a unique binary pattern. For traders and financial analysts who rely on algorithm-based trading systems, understanding that these algorithms operate in binary highlights the precision and speed involved in processing market data.

This binary machine language sits beneath high-level programming languages like Python or Java. While developers write in clear terms, the underlying hardware interprets and executes these instructions in binary, making the entire computing operation efficient and precise.

Binary Communication Protocols

In data transmission, binary protocols govern how devices exchange information. Whether it’s sending stock prices across a network or transferring files between smartphones, data packets use binary sequences to ensure clarity and error detection. Protocols like TCP/IP or Bluetooth depend on binary’s simplicity to maintain connection integrity and synchronise data.

For Indian investors using online trading apps, reliable binary communication protocols ensure that real-time data arrives accurately and quickly, preventing costly delays or errors. Moreover, encryption schemes often work with binary representations to secure sensitive information during transmission, safeguarding financial transactions.

Binary representation is not just a technical concept—it’s the silent workhorse powering the digital economy, offering precise control, fast processing, and secure communication across various sectors.

This foundational role of binary makes it indispensable for anyone dealing with technology, especially in fast-moving domains like finance and trading where timing and accuracy can affect crore-rupee decisions.

FAQ

Similar Articles

4.8/5

Based on 11 reviews